I am on the verge of getting a new vehicle & thought I'd ask the advice of
Phono-L members since, like myself, you all have need to haul antique
phonographs. I'd like to have cargo capacity to transport the "typical"
Victrola (XVI), the "typical" Edison Diamond Disc Phonograph (C-250) as well
the Orthophonic "Credenza" - when I need to haul an
Orthophonic changer or a Capehart, I'll continue to use my 1969 GMC pickup.
I want a smaller, more economical 4 cylinder vehicle & have looked at Hondas
(all of which have
too small a cargo area except the "Element" which I consider unattractive) &
Toyotas (Scion, Metric, RAV 4 & Venza,all of which will accommodate the
above mentioned machines) & am leaning towards the RAV4 but thought it might
be nice to get your input before making a final decision. Thanks!
